Some of the many new products used to help an individual to stop smoking are really very effective. Counseling services, reading materials, medicines, and patches are all widely available and have produced some amazing results. Educational materials alone may be the best beginning start to an attempt to quit because once you know what kind of damage you are doing to your body the prudent and reasonable person will definitely see that it is the very best thing to do. However, it has been documented and researched that the highest success rates occur when a combination of methods are used simultaneously. Hardly a day goes by when you dont need to lift something. For these situations, there are a few really easy rules to remember. Always remember to bend your knees, and from a squatting position lift the item. Make sure that your back is arched to provide maximum power, and the item you are lifting is held as close to your body as possible. Lifting heavy items frequently causes injuries and back pain, and surprisingly proper technique is still mostly ignored. So if you use the same stance that is utilized by athletes in many different sports, you can provide great protection for your back.

An active mind is a healthy mind, so keeping your mind sharp is a good portion of aging well and living a better life as you grow older. If you continue to challenge and engage your brain with activities such as continued learning and healthy dieting you can maintain your healthy brain. Some activities like completing daily crossword puzzles or learning a hobby, or maybe exploring a new language will add content and continued exercise of the brain. Expanding your horizons daily and engaging in activities that require you to think on your feet and assess information quickly and accurately will make a world of difference as you grow older. Sometimes it may take a little more effort than it used to require, but continuing to stretch your brain muscles will definitely pay off in good memory and cognitive skills.
